Safety

As parents, your primary priority is the safety of your children. It is vital to select a stroller that meets the most stringent safety standards. Look for the AS/NZS 2088 safety standard, a sturdy frame and a 5-point harness. Also, look for pinch points. These are areas where children's fingers may get trapped, or crushed in the event that they hang from the handles of the stroller. Always lock the folding mechanism to avoid accidental opening. Do not let your child climb on or hang from the handles. If you're using a stroller for jogging, always use the front wheel parking brake and ensure it's locked during exercise or when traveling over rough terrain. Check the wheels and add air when necessary.
